•Review of the use of Bourdieu's work in management and organization studies.•Capital, habitus and field are seldom used in a comprehensive way.•Discusses contributions of Bourdieu's work to a micro-foundation of institutional theory.•Discusses contributions of Bourdieu's work to reflection of academic practices.

SummaryThe work of the French sociologist Pierre Bourdieu has received increased attention in management and organization studies (MOS). However, the full potential of his work has so far rarely been exploited. This paper aims to pinpoint the contributions of Bourdieu's work to research in MOS. I conducted a citation context analysis of nine leading journals to investigate how citations to Bourdieu's work have developed over time, which contents from Bourdieu's work are cited and how comprehensively researchers have so far engaged with Bourdieu. Based on these findings, I discuss how Bourdieu's work may contribute to research in MOS, particularly to a micro-foundation of new institutional theory and to the reflection of academic practice in MOS.
